Output 13a8324111741a7d3e2611a9b1069cf582ed5245953ebff2daa1d79807ce17f5:3

value
18116120
script pubkey
OP_0 OP_PUSHBYTES_20 d890cba39d1056bc50529667f2b1d6723e1dc0e1
address
ltc1qmzgvhguazpttc5zjjenl9vwkwglpms8pk93zu9
transaction
13a8324111741a7d3e2611a9b1069cf582ed5245953ebff2daa1d79807ce17f5
spent
true